At its core, an ankle monitor is a wearable device used to track a personโ€™s location as part of a court-ordered supervision program. These devices are typically secured around the ankle and communicate with a monitoring center through cellular networks, using GPS or radio frequency to report location data at regular intervals. Monitors are programmed to alert the supervising agency if a person enters restricted areas, fails to check in on time, or attempts to tamper with the device. Courts and probation officers use this information to make decisions about compliance, adjusting conditions as necessary to support rehabilitation while protecting community safety. Things People Often Misunderstand

A common misconception is that ankle monitors are purely punitive, when in reality they are often used as part of diversion programs, probation conditions, or reentry support. Another misunderstanding involves the precision and reliability of location data; while modern devices are generally accurate, factors like signal interference or technical malfunctions can occasionally affect reporting. It is also frequently assumed that all monitoring is visible or widely known, when in many cases the information is shared only with authorized agencies and not broadcast to the public. Clarifying these points helps replace speculation with informed understanding.

People sometimes believe that wearing an ankle monitor means a complete loss of freedom, yet most programs include specific allowances for work, medical appointments, religious services, and family obligations. Understanding the rules, which vary by jurisdiction and individual circumstances, can make a significant difference in day-to-day experience.
